The word trollop is a complex and highly derogatory noun with a long history in the English language. This lesson explores its two primary meanings: a woman perceived as sexually promiscuous and a woman who is dirty or slovenly. We examine how the word's focus has shifted over time from simple untidiness to moral judgment. By reviewing historical context, synonyms like harlot and slattern, and specific usage examples, you will understand why this term is considered archaic and offensive today.
